吸烟者外周血单个核细胞差异表达miRNA与mRNA调控网络  

The regulatory network of dysregulated microRNAs and mRNAs in peripheral mononuclear cells of cigarette smokers

摘  要:目的探讨吸烟者外周血单个核细胞(PBMC)差异表达的miRNA与mRNA调控网络及相关信号通路。方法收集20名健康非吸烟者与17名健康吸烟者的外周静脉血,分离PBMC后提取总RNA,分别进行miRNA和mRNA表达谱芯片检测。在差异表达的miRNA和mRNA范围内通过数据库预测miRNA对mRNA的调控关系,并进行信号通路富集分析。结果与健康非吸烟者相比,吸烟者PBMC有miRNA与mRNA的差异表达,其差异表达基因的GO富集分析表明,血小板来源生长因子信号通路、胆囊收缩素受体信号通路、T细胞活化和表皮生长因子受体信号通路是主要的信号通路。结论吸烟者PBMC中差异表达的miRNA与mRNA调控网络可能与某些疾病的潜在危险因素相关。Objective To explore the regulatory network of dysregulated microRNAs and mRNAs and related signaling pathways in peripheral mononuclear cells(PBMCs)of cigarette smokers.Methods The peripheral venous blood was taken from 20 healthy non-smokers and 17 healthy smokers.The miRNA and mRNA expression profile of PBMCs was examined by miRNA and mRNA array.The regulatory relationship between dysregulated miRNAs and mRNAs was predicted and the signaling pathways were enriched.Results Compared with the healthy non-smokers,the smokers had dysregulated miRNAs and mRNAs.The GO enrichment analysis indicated that PDGF signaling pathway,CCKR signaling map,T cell activation and EGF receptor signaling pathway were enriched in the smokers.Conclusion The regulatory network of dysregulated miRNAs and mRNAs in PBMCs of smokers may be related to some potential risk factors for certain diseases.
